Re: Anyone changed window regulator
There is nothing to it. Roll the window all the way down. Pull the clip for the crank handle and pull off the handle. Take of the door panel and peel back the plasitc. Unbolt the 2 bolts that hold the window to the arm and pull the window out. There are 4 bolts that hold the regulator to the door (at least on a 90, I'd assume it's very similar) unbolt them and pull the regulator out through the large opening at the bottom of the door (or wherever there is room). Make sure nothing is bent on the regulator and give it a good cleaning with brake fluid. You might want to take off the spring and inspect it and make sure there are no bits between the coils. Put it all back together and lube it up with some good grease. Now do the whole thing backwards. Make sure the glass slides into the channels and I'd recommend getting some spray silicone lubricant and giving the window channels a good spray before putting the window back in.
